Early defenders of women’s intellectual rights: Wollstonecraft’s and Rokeya’s strategies to promote female education
Given that social constructions and deeply embedded cultural misapprehensions about gender, together with conventional views of female intellectual ability, denied women entry into institutional education, Wollstonecraft and Rokeya mounted a literary campaign to promote female education in their res...
